 What kind of cheese slices?  American? Milk-based?  Oil-based?  2% or full fat?

Four slices of Kraft 2% American would be 180 calories, 16g of protein, 8g of carbs, and 8g of fat. There could definitely be worse things to eat.  Two eggs has more calories, less protein, and more fat than that.  And depending on what your nut says, a certain amount of carbs and fat are OK.
